20 Mar, 2026Strategic overview
Over 175 years in business, serving more than 40 million customers and ranking as the 4th largest life insurer in North America by market capitalization.
$3.3 trillion in client assets, with over $1 trillion in assets under management or advisement.
Diversified operations across Canada, the U.S., Europe, and Capital & Risk Solutions (CRS), each contributing significantly to base and net earnings.
Strategic focus on building leading companies in stable markets, investing in leadership, and maintaining capital and risk discipline.
Execution priorities include customer-centricity, digital transformation, operational excellence, and foundational principles of diversification and capital discipline.
Market trends and growth opportunities
Aging populations and a growing retirement savings gap are driving demand for retirement solutions in core markets.
Corporates are increasingly seeking risk management tools, with UK pension risk transfer volumes rising.
Attractive reinvestment opportunities identified in Empower (U.S.), Canadian wealth management, Irish wealth, UK bulk annuities, and CRS.
Efficiency initiatives are enhancing operating leverage across all business segments.
Financial performance and objectives
2025 base earnings reached $4.6B, with net earnings at $4.0B; U.S. and Canada are the largest contributors.
Medium-term ambitions target 8-10% base EPS growth, double-digit U.S. earnings growth, and mid-single-digit growth in other segments.
Base ROE consistently above 17%, with a 5-year CAGR of 12% for base EPS.
Base capital generation exceeds 80%, supporting strong dividend payouts and deployable capital.
5-year annualized total shareholder return of 23.5%, outpacing major indices by over 700 basis points.
